YM150 for Prevention of Venous Thromboembolism in Patients With Acute Medical Illness

A Multi-center, Open Label Study With YM150, a Direct Factor Xa Inhibitor for Prevention of Venous Thromboembolism in Patients With Acute Medical Illness

Brief summary

To evaluate the safety and efficacy of the oral dose of YM150 for prevention of venous thromboembolism (VTE) in patients with acute medical illness.

Inclusion criteria

* Patient is hospitalized within 2 days before the study and has more than 1 basic VTE risks * Complete bed rest is required in the fist day of hospitalization and at least 4 days hospitalization * Written informed consent obtained

Exclusion criteria

* Subject has history of deep vein thrombosis and/or pulmonary embolism * Subject has a hemorrhagic disorder and/or coagulation disorder * Subject has had clinically important bleeding occurred within 90 days prior to obtaining informed consent * Subject has an acute bacterial endocarditis * Subject has uncontrolled severe or moderate hypertension, retinopathy, myocardial infarction or stroke * Subject is receiving anticoagulants/antiplatelet agents * Subject has a body weight less than 40 kg * Major trauma, major surgery, eye, spinal cord and/or brain surgery within 90 days prior to obtaining informed consent, or the subject scheduled for these surgeries during the study periods
